About the job
As an MDM-developer with Strawberry you will have primary responsibility for development and architecture in our MDM-software (EBX), as well as participating in - and driving masterdata-projects across the organization. As a summary your role will consist of the following (among many):
- Development and architecture in EBX, including our current upgrade from EBX5 to EBX6
- Project of structure rebranding of hotels
- Contributing to the overall master data strategy
- Building a common data language and anchoring data ownership across our organization
- Leading and participating in projects related to master data
- Building strong relationships with relevant stakeholders and ensuring data quality
- Identifying and implementing best practices in data quality and governance
